It would definitely be an interesting story to bring to life! Kreia, also known as Darth Traya, is a complex character Star Wars: Knights of the Old Republic II – Lords of the Sith.
She is a former Jedi Master and later Sith Lord. Disillusioned with the Jedi Order and Sith dogma, Kreia seeks to challenge and ultimately dismantle the Force’s influence on the galaxy.
His motivations are driven by the belief that both the light and dark sides are flawed, perpetuating a cycle of conflict. Acting as a mentor to the protagonist, the Jedi Exile, he provides guidance and criticism, pushing the Exile to question his own beliefs and the nature of the Force itself.
Kreia’s ultimate goal is to free the galaxy from the manipulations of the Force.
